Caving

The alluring, challenging and mysterious experience offered by the caves in Eastern Visayas will satiate the unending quest of adventurers seeking out the unexplored wonders of creation.  The 840-hectare protected area of Sohoton Natural Bridge National Park in Basey, Samar and the cavernous magnificent caves of Calbiga, with its karst of 999 sq. kms. will enchant the discriminating adventurers.

Fit for both amateur and professional spelunkers, other activities are also possible in these caves.

Trips are customized and can be arranged with DOT-8, the DENR-8 or the local government units.

Diving

Scattered throughout Eastern Visayas are unexplored, well-preserved dive sites known only to a few adventurous divers... an entirely different world lurks under the island of Limasawa in Southern Leyte, where walls of indescribable array of corals wait to be admired by divers.  The nearby town of Padre Burgos also offers beautiful dive sites visited only by a few - the Kalanggaman Island in Palompon, Leyte beckons to the amateur divers.  Here also, the dolphins coming from San Bernardino Strait frolick with divers and local travelers.

All trips need local dive experts for maximum enjoyment.

 

Surfing

Known to an "elite few" - the Pacific coastal towns of Eastern Samar is a haven for surfers amateurs and professionals alike.  The remoteness of these towns give the surfers a "proprietary" sense of the enormous Pacific untamed waves, challenging surfers for an ultimate experience.

Trekking

Take an intimate, personalized travel to commune with nature to the Mahagnao Volcano National Park in Burauen, Leyte.  Blessed with two inactive volcanoes, the lush vegetation provides enormous peace and tranquility as a balm to modern life.  Hot springs, narrow pathways and sun-beamed river banks make a unique soft adventure for amateur hikers.  The fresh mountain air adds an invigorating experience to the trekker.

Select a day and a custom-built itinerary will be designed by the local government unit in Burauen to suit your personal interests.

Best in the summer months of March to June.  DENR-8 and DOT-8 will be around to facilitate your travel needs.
